How to fill out non participating provider dispute

01
Step 1: Gather all relevant documentation such as the Explanation of Benefits (EOB) statement, any correspondence from the insurance company, and any other supporting documents.
02
Step 2: Review the EOB statement and any other relevant documents to understand the reason for the dispute and the amount in question.
03
Step 3: Contact the insurance company's customer service department and inform them of your intention to file a non-participating provider dispute. Obtain any necessary forms or instructions for filing the dispute.
04
Step 4: Fill out the non-participating provider dispute form accurately and completely, including all required information such as your contact details, the name of the provider, the disputed charges, and the reason for the dispute.
05
Step 5: Attach any supporting documentation to the dispute form, such as copies of the EOB statement or any correspondence that highlights the discrepancies or errors.
06
Step 6: Make a copy of the completed dispute form and all supporting documents for your records.
07
Step 7: Submit the dispute form and supporting documents to the designated address provided by the insurance company. Consider sending the documents via certified mail or with delivery confirmation to ensure they are received.
08
Step 8: Keep a record of the date and time when the dispute documents were sent, as well as any tracking numbers or other relevant information.
09
Step 9: Follow up with the insurance company after a reasonable amount of time has passed to ensure that the dispute is being processed and to inquire about any additional steps or information that may be required.
10
Step 10: Continue to communicate with the insurance company until a resolution is reached. Be proactive in providing any requested information or additional documentation to support your claim.
11
Step 11: Keep records of all correspondence, including names and contact information of insurance company representatives, for future reference.
12
Step 12: If a satisfactory resolution is not achieved through the non-participating provider dispute process, consider seeking legal advice or contacting a consumer advocacy organization for further assistance.

Non participating provider dispute is a process where a healthcare provider challenges the payment or denial of a claim by an insurance company that they do not have a contract with.
The healthcare provider who did not have a contract with the insurance company and is disputing the payment or denial of a claim is required to file a non participating provider dispute.
The non participating provider dispute can be filled out by providing detailed information about the claim, the services provided, and reasons for disputing the payment or denial.
The purpose of non participating provider dispute is to resolve payment or denial issues between healthcare providers and insurance companies where there is no contract in place.
The information that must be reported on non participating provider dispute includes details of the claim, services provided, reasons for disputing, and any supporting documentation.
